How much bloating is normal?

7 replies

Melbs6 · 07/01/2020 19:33

I’m 7 weeks today and I am so bloated it’s painful. My jeans which were on the big side before I got pregnant are now uncomfortably tight and I can barely do them up. When I look in the mirror I already look 5 months pregnant. I know it can’t be a bump because I’m only 7 weeks. This is my first so I have no idea if this is normal or not? Is it normal? And does anyone know any antibloat remedies that are safe in pregnancy? Thanks x

Boymummy3 · 07/01/2020 19:34

Yes it's normal and it will go down.

tamarisk44 · 07/01/2020 20:01

I was the same! I had to wear really baggy clothes because I looked so pregnant even though I knew it wasn't an actual bump. At some point my bloating and actual bump kind of merged and I could start to enjoy looking pregnant!

ThinkPink71 · 07/01/2020 20:04

God I was the same..it was awful. The worst part about the first 12 weeks actually. It was so so painful as well as I had awful wind. (sorry too much info).

The good news is it deffo goes...mine went about the 14 week mark I think. Just try wear baggy clothes...nothing that presses against your belly & try peppermint tea xx
